    Facility Officer

    About the Role

    • We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ented individual to join our team as a Facility Officer. You will be responsible for the day-to-day maintenance and operation of our facilities, ensuring a safe, clean, and functional environment for our employees and visitors.

    Responsibilities

    • Perform routine inspections of the facilities, including buildings, grounds, and equipment, to identify and address any potential issues.
    • Schedule and oversee preventative maintenance activities, such as repairs, cleaning, and replacement of equipment.
    • Conduct minor repairs and troubleshooting of facility systems, such as electrical, plumbing, and HVAC.
    • Coordinate with external vendors for repairs and services beyond your expertise.
    • Ensure compliance with all relevant safety and environmental regulations.
    • Manage janitorial services and maintain a clean and sanitary environment.
    • Maintain accurate records of all maintenance activities and repairs.
    • Implement and manage energy-saving initiatives to reduce operational costs.
    • Respond to and resolve tenant and employee inquiries and complaints promptly and effectively.
    • Contribute to the development and implementation of emergency preparedness plans.
    • Assist with special events and other facility-related projects as needed.

    Qualifications

    • High School Diploma or equivalent.
    • Minimum of 2 years of experience in a facility management role.
    • Strong knowledge of building maintenance and repair procedures.
    • Exc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ting skills.
    • Proven ability to work independently and as part of a team.
    •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
    • Excellent organizational and time management skills.
    •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ite.
    • Ability to lift and carry heavy objects.
    • Valid driver's license.
    • Certified in CPR and First Aid (preferred).
